Grow with AppMaster Grow with AppMaster.
Become our partner arrow ico

No-Code UI for Mobile Apps: Designing Cross-Platform Interfaces

No-Code UI for Mobile Apps: Designing Cross-Platform Interfaces

No-Code Mobile App Development: An Overview

No-code mobile app development has rapidly gained popularity in recent years, enabling entrepreneurs, businesses, and even citizen developers to build full-featured mobile apps without needing to write any code. These platforms empower users to easily create functional and visually appealing mobile applications by leveraging pre-built components, drag-and-drop interfaces, and visual logic builders.

The no-code revolution has democratized the app development process and made it more accessible and cost-effective. Many no-code platforms have an extensive library of UI components, templates, and design elements that simplify designing and deploying applications across multiple platforms, such as Android and iOS. Users can visually design their app layouts, configure features, and set up logic and interactions, all without needing any programming knowledge.

Some prominent examples of no-code app development platforms include AppMaster, OutSystems, Wappler, and Bubble. These platforms allow you to rapidly prototype and build full-fledged mobile applications that adhere to industry standards and best practices regarding user experience, performance, and quality.

The Importance of Cross-Platform UI in Mobile App Development

Cross-platform UI design is a crucial consideration in mobile app development, as it ensures that your application delivers a consistent and engaging user experience across different devices and platforms. In the era of increasing device fragmentation, designing a cross-platform UI helps avoid the time-consuming and resource-intensive process of building separate apps for each platform. Businesses can reach a wider audience and maintain a strong brand identity across platforms by creating a single app that works seamlessly on multiple operating systems.

Furthermore, focusing on cross-platform UI allows you to streamline your development process, and reduce maintenance and app update efforts. Cross-platform UI design also fosters increased collaboration between designers, developers, and other team members, as there is a single set of requirements, design guidelines, and best practices to follow. This unified approach to app development promotes efficiency and paves the way for a smoother deployment process.

UI in Mobile App Development

Key Elements of No-Code UI Design for Mobile Apps

Designing an effective and user-friendly mobile app UI using no-code tools involves several key elements for delivering a successful and engaging app. Here are the main aspects of no-code UI design that you need to consider:

  • Choosing the right no-code platform: With numerous no-code platforms available in the market, choosing the one that best aligns with your specific needs and requirements is essential. Look for a platform that offers a wide range of pre-built components, templates, and powerful features that enable you to create customizable and flexible UI designs.
  • Understanding design principles and user expectations: Before diving into app development, familiarize yourself with fundamental design principles and user expectations. This includes color themes, typography, iconography, and branding guidelines, ensuring your app is visually appealing and adheres to established design standards. Moreover, it's crucial to understand and anticipate your target audience's needs and preferences, enabling you to create a functional and engaging app.
  • Designing reusable UI components: To streamline your no-code UI design process, create reusable UI components that can be easily adapted and modified to suit different platforms and devices. This not only speeds up the app development process but also ensures consistency across various screens and user interactions.
  • Ensuring cross-platform compatibility: To achieve a seamless cross-platform UI, it's essential to consider each platform's specific guidelines and requirements, such as Android and iOS. Design your app with flexibility in mind, so it works seamlessly across various devices and form factors.
  • Incorporating user testing and feedback early in the process: User testing and feedback are crucial for creating a successful mobile app UI. Test your app with real users early in the development process to identify potential issues and areas for improvement. Use these insights to iteratively refine and perfect your UI design, ensuring an optimal user experience.

By combining these key elements, you can create an engaging, user-friendly mobile app UI using a no-code platform, and bring your app idea to life quickly and efficiently.

Streamlining the Design Process with AppMaster

As a no-code development platform, AppMaster offers an efficient and user-friendly way to streamline the mobile app UI design process. It allows users to create applications for backend, web, and mobile using visual design tools, significantly reducing the time and effort required for app development. Here's how AppMaster simplifies the design process:

Try AppMaster no-code today!
Platform can build any web, mobile or backend application 10x faster and 3x cheaper
Start Free

Drag-and-Drop Interface

With its intuitive drag-and-drop interface, AppMaster makes it easy to create UI layouts without writing a single line of code. Users can simply select UI components from a library and drag them to the interface, rearranging elements and customizing their appearance as needed. This approach enables rapid prototyping and accelerates the design process.

Pre-Built Components and Templates

AppMaster provides a comprehensive set of pre-built components and templates that users can readily incorporate into their mobile app UIs. These components are designed for cross-platform compatibility, ensuring uniform performance and appearance on various devices and platforms. By using these convenient building blocks, users can focus on creating an engaging app while eliminating the need for manual coding.

Flexible Business Logic and APIs

Aside from designing the visual interface, AppMaster allows users to set up the underlying business logic of the app using its visual Business Process (BP) Designer. The platform also supports REST API and WSS endpoints, enabling quick and seamless integration with other systems, databases, or third-party services. This built-in convenience ensures that the app is visually compelling, fully functional, and interactive.

Efficient App Generation and Deployment

After designing the UI and defining the business logic, AppMaster generates the application source code using industry-standard frameworks and languages, compiles it, runs tests, and packages it into Docker containers for deployment. This process ensures the app is free of technical debt and can scale as needed for enterprise and high-load use cases, delivering a high-quality end product.

Designing UI Components for Cross-Platform Compatibility

Creating UI components with cross-platform compatibility in mind is essential for a consistent user experience across various devices and platforms. Below are some steps for designing UI components that work seamlessly on different operating systems and screen sizes:

Understand Target Devices and Platform Guidelines

The first step in designing cross-platform UI components is to familiarize yourself with the target devices' capabilities, screen sizes, and resolutions and the specific design guidelines for each platform (e.g., Android's Material Design and Apple's Human Interface Guidelines). Understanding these factors will help you create UI components that look and function consistently across various platforms while adhering to established design principles.

Create Reusable Components

An essential aspect of cross-platform UI design is creating reusable components that can be easily adapted and customized for different devices and platforms. Developing a consistent design language with shared elements, styles, and interactions will simplify the design process and make it easier to maintain and update the app as needed.

Adhere to Responsive Design Principles

Responsive design is a critical aspect of cross-platform UI design, as it ensures that UI components adjust to fit different screen sizes and orientations. By designing with responsiveness in mind, you can guarantee that your app provides a consistent user experience on various devices.

Utilize No-Code Tools and Resources

Platforms like AppMaster offer an array of resources and tools to help you design cross-platform UI components efficiently. By leveraging these tools, you can streamline the design process and focus on creating an app that meets your target audience's needs and expectations.

Tips for Creating an Effective and User-Friendly No-Code Mobile App UI

Designing a user-friendly and effective no-code mobile app UI is critical to the app's success. Here are some tips to help you create an engaging and accessible user experience:

  1. Prioritize User Experience - Always keep the end user in mind when designing your app's UI. Focus on making the app intuitive, easy to navigate, and responsive to various devices and platforms to provide the best possible user experience.
  2. Adhere to Design Principles - Familiarize yourself with established design principles and platform-specific guidelines to create a visually appealing and consistent interface across different platforms and devices.
  3. Use Visually Engaging Elements - Incorporate visually engaging elements such as icons, images, and animations to create an aesthetically pleasing and user-friendly app. But avoid cluttering the interface with excessive visuals that may distract or confuse users.
  4. Optimize Interactions - Design user interactions that are intuitive, simple, and efficient. Ensure that touch targets are large enough for easy access and employ meaningful feedback mechanisms, such as visual cues and animations, to communicate the results of user actions.
  5. Ensure Responsiveness - As mentioned earlier, responsive design is essential for a consistent user experience across multiple devices. Design your app's UI to accommodate various screen sizes, resolutions, and orientations to ensure optimal usability.
  6. Cater to Accessibility and Usability Requirements - Prioritize inclusivity by designing your app to meet the needs of users with diverse abilities. Consider incorporating features such as larger fonts, high-contrast color schemes, and accessible navigation options to make your app more accessible and usable for all users.
Try AppMaster no-code today!
Platform can build any web, mobile or backend application 10x faster and 3x cheaper
Start Free

By following these tips and leveraging the power of no-code platforms like AppMaster, you can create effective, cross-platform mobile app UIs that cater to a broad range of user needs and expectations, leading to a successful and engaging app.

Best Practices for Testing and Validation

Validating your no-code mobile app UI is essential to ensuring a smooth, user-friendly experience for your app users. Proper testing helps to identify and eliminate bugs, usability issues, and other problems before releasing your mobile app to a wider audience. Here are some best practices for testing and validation:

  1. Usability testing with real users: Conduct usability tests using real users to evaluate and refine the user experience. Observing users interacting with the app provides valuable insights into possible improvements and helps identify potential issues. Consider different user profiles, such as age, technical background, and usage context, to cater the design to diverse users.
  2. Regular testing on various devices and platforms: To ensure compatibility and responsiveness, perform regular tests on different devices, screen sizes, and platforms. This practice helps identify inconsistencies, performance issues, or other problems when your mobile app runs on different systems and hardware.
  3. Gather user feedback: Collect feedback from your users to identify areas of improvement based on their real-world experiences. Leverage this feedback to prioritize fixes and enhancements. Consider using in-app surveys, beta testing programs, or app store reviews to get valuable user input.
  4. Incorporate data-driven insights: Analyzing usage data and metrics can help you make informed decisions about design changes and improvements. Monitor app engagement, user retention, session duration, and other relevant statistics to identify trends, patterns, and pain points. These insights can help guide your UI improvements and validate your design choices.
  5. Iterate on your design: Continuously refine and develop your app based on the feedback and insights you gather. Regularly update your design and test its impact on user experience to ensure an optimal and up-to-date interface.

Embracing the Future of Mobile App Development with No-Code Platforms

The rise of no-code platforms like AppMaster has transformed the mobile app development industry, making it more accessible and efficient. By embracing these powerful tools, developers and designers can create sophisticated mobile apps with less effort, cost, and time.

Here are some compelling reasons to consider using no-code platforms for mobile app development:

  • Shorter development timeline: No-code platforms enable rapid development and deployment of mobile apps with minimal coding effort. This approach significantly reduces the time required to build a functional and visually appealing app, allowing developers to focus on perfecting the user experience.
  • Reduced project costs: By eliminating or reducing the need for coding, no-code platforms help cut down development costs. Businesses can create high-quality mobile apps with a smaller budget, making app development more affordable and feasible for startups and smaller organizations.
  • Easier app maintenance: No-code platforms make maintaining and updating mobile apps easier, as changes can be implemented more efficiently. This approach helps keep your app up-to-date with evolving user expectations, design trends, and platform requirements.
  • Improved collaboration: No-code platforms facilitate better collaboration between developers, designers, and other stakeholders. Team members can easily access and contribute to the project, enabling a more agile development process.
  • Increased opportunities for innovation and experimentation: With no-code platforms, designing and developing mobile apps becomes less intimidating and more rewarding. This environment encourages creative experimentation and risk-taking, helping businesses expand their offerings and stay ahead in the competitive mobile app market.

No-code platforms like AppMaster have opened up new possibilities for mobile app development, allowing more people to create and launch apps easily and efficiently. By adopting these innovative tools, you can build cross-platform mobile app user interfaces tailored to your target audience and stay ahead in the ever-evolving world of technology.

How does AppMaster help in streamlining the design process?

AppMaster, a powerful no-code platform, enables users to easily create mobile app UIs using a drag-and-drop interface. It also provides a set of pre-built components and helps in designing and deploying the business logic, ensuring optimal cross-platform compatibility and responsiveness.

What is no-code mobile app development?

No-code mobile app development refers to creating mobile applications using platforms and tools that do not require any programming knowledge. Users can build apps by visually designing their user interfaces, setting up logic and interactions, and configuring features using pre-built components.

What are the key elements of no-code UI design for mobile apps?

Key elements of no-code UI design for mobile apps include selecting the right no-code platform, understanding design principles and user expectations, designing reusable UI components, ensuring cross-platform compatibility, and conducting user testing and validation.

What are the best practices for testing and validation?

Best practices for testing and validating no-code mobile app UIs include performing usability testing with real users, regular testing on various devices and platforms, gathering user feedback, and incorporating changes based on data-driven insights to improve the overall app experience.

What is the process of designing UI components for cross-platform compatibility?

Designing UI components for cross-platform compatibility involves understanding target devices and platform guidelines, creating reusable components, adhering to design best practices, and utilizing available tools and resources for cross-platform UI design, such as AppMaster.

Why is cross-platform UI important in mobile app development?

Cross-platform UI is essential because it helps in delivering a consistent and engaging user experience across different devices and platforms. This approach saves development time and resources by building a single app that works seamlessly on multiple operating systems such as Android and iOS.

How can one create an effective and user-friendly no-code mobile app UI?

To create an effective and user-friendly no-code mobile app UI, follow these tips: prioritize user experience, adhere to design principles, use visually engaging elements, optimize interactions, ensure responsiveness, and cater to accessibility and usability requirements.

Why should one embrace no-code platforms for mobile app development?

Embracing no-code platforms for mobile app development offers multiple benefits, such as a shorter development timeline, reduced overall project costs, easier app maintenance, improved collaboration, and increased opportunities for innovation and experimentation in app design.

Related Posts

Why PWAs Are the Future of Web Development: A Complete Guide
Why PWAs Are the Future of Web Development: A Complete Guide
Progressive Web Apps (PWAs) blend the best of web and mobile apps. Discover why they're the future of web development, offering speed, adaptability, and user engagement.
Top AR/VR Trends Shaping the Future of App Development
Top AR/VR Trends Shaping the Future of App Development
Explore how AR/VR trends are revolutionizing app development. Delve into cutting-edge advancements, industry insights, and predictions shaping future applications.
The Future of AR/VR in Business Applications: What You Need to Know
The Future of AR/VR in Business Applications: What You Need to Know
Explore the transformative role of AR/VR in business applications, highlighting emerging trends and innovative use cases shaping the future of industry practices.
GET STARTED FREE
Inspired to try this yourself?

The best way to understand the power of AppMaster is to see it for yourself. Make your own application in minutes with free subscription

Bring Your Ideas to Life